Martha FARRINGTON Steward 1702–1777 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1702

Birth Location: Andover, Essex, Massachusetts, United States

Death Date: 06 Nov 1777

Death Location: Lunenburg, Worcester, Massachusetts, USA

Father: Edward Farrington

Mother: Martha Browne

Spouse(s): Solomon Steward

Children(s): Jacob Stewart

In 1702, Martha FARRINGTON Steward entered the world in Andover, Essex, Massachusetts, United States, born to Edward Farrington And Martha Browne. Martha FARRINGTON Steward married Solomon Steward, and had children including Jacob Stewart. Martha FARRINGTON Steward passed away in 1777 in Lunenburg, Worcester, Massachusetts, USA.
